Constituting Development JPGConstituting Development in Somaliland
Mercatus Event
October 7, 2009  12:30 PM
The Social Change Project at the Mercatus Center presented a lecture by Sujai Shivakumar, Senior Program Officer at the National Academies. Dr. Shivakumar discussed the importance of crafting institutions for economic development and shared his experiences from advising the Somaliland government and civil society on developing a constitution. The presentation drew on Dr. Shivakumar's research at the Workshop in Political Theory and Policy Analysis at Indiana University as well as fieldwork in fostering a constitutional framework in Somaliland.

Event IconInnovating Our Way Forward: Today's Idea, Tomorrow's Solution
Mercatus Event
September 30, 2009  1:45 PM
Karol Boudreaux participated in a panel titled Intellectual Property: The Path From Ideas to Solutions at the 6th annual Chamber of Commerce conference on Intellectual Property.  Ms. Boudreaux discussed her work on genetically modified seed in South Africa and the importance of intellectual property rights to development.

Event IconReligion, Business, and Peace Conference
Speeches and Presentations
September 24, 2009  9:0 AM
This conference, coordinated by the Institute for Corporate Responsibility in collaboration with the C12 Group and the GWU Department of Religious Studies, examined the way businesses help to create peaceful societies. Enterprise Africa! lead researcher, Karol Boudreaux, presented her findings on the links between the coffee industry and reconciliation in Rwanda.
